FREEZE WARNING NOTICE
Wednesday morning, December 2nd temperatures are forecast to bottom-out in the lower 30s Wednesday morning. A light breeze will knock wind chills down into the lower 20s. When the weather is very cold outside, let the cold water drip from the faucet served by exposed pipes. Running water through the pipe - even at a trickle - helps prevent pipes from freezing. Remove, drain, and store hoses used outdoors. Close inside valves supplying outdoor hose bibs. Open the outside hose bibs to allow water to drain. Keep the outside valve open so that any water remaining in the pipe can expand without causing the pipe to break. If you will be going away during cold weather, leave the heat on in your home, set to a temperature no lower than 55° F. If you turn on a faucet and only a trickle comes out, suspect a frozen pipe. Keep the faucet open. As you treat the frozen pipe and the frozen area begins to melt, water will begin to flow through the frozen area. Running water through the pipe will help melt ice in the pipe. Please stay home until the water flows fully through the lines to ensure the pipes do not burst and flood the home and make sure there are no obstructions that would flood the home through not being able to drain when the water does thaw and flow. APPLY FOR UNEMPLOYMENT BENEFITS

Your first step is to submit an initial claim in order for DEW to determine if your circumstances meet the eligibility requirements of the UI program. Filing a claim is the only way for eligibility to be determined.

Initial claims are filed online through the MyBenefits portal. https://scuihub.dew.sc.gov/
• Once you have submitted your application, DEW will review your claim and determine if you qualify for benefits.
• Within a week after applying, you will receive a Monetary Determination by mail outlining your potential weekly and maximum benefits amounts. The maximum weekly benefit amount in South Carolina is $326 before taxes. A Monetary Determination only outlines your monetary eligibility, and does not mean that you meet all eligibility requirements.
• You may be asked to submit certain types of information to DEW in order to determine if you are eligible to receive benefits. This can be competed through the upload feature in the benefits portal, faxed or emailed. For more information on how to do this, please contact 1-866-831-1724.
• You should receive a final eligibility decision by mail within 21 days of receiving the Monetary Determination. If you are deemed eligible, please note that you will not be paid for the first week of eligibility in each benefit year; this is considered a waiting week.
• You may check your benefit status via MyBenefits or TelClaim.
• When applying for benefits, you will choose to receive benefit payments by debit card or direct deposit. For more information, please visit our payment page. Please note that you are required to pay taxes on UI benefits.

The information you provide DEW when filing a claim for UI is held confidential but may be shared with other state and/or federal agencies administering unemployment insurance programs or other government programs.
